Product Summary
The Parameter Total Nitric Oxide kit has two assay options. Endogenous nitrite is measured in the first option. In the second option, nitrate is converted to nitrite using nitrate reductase and total nitrite is measured. To obtain the nitrate concentration, endogenous nitrite is subtracted from the total nitrite value.
Recovery
The recovery of the nitrate standard spiked to levels throughout the range of the assay in various matrices was evaluated.
Sample Type | Average % Recovery | Range % |
---|---|---|
Cell Culture Supernates (Nitrite Assay) (n=10) | 107 | 91-115 |
Plasma (Nitrate Assay) (n=25) | 98 | 87-110 |
Plasma (Nitrite Assay) (n=20) | 104 | 92-117 |
Serum (Nitrate Assay) (n=10) | 95 | 89-101 |
Serum (Nitrite Assay) (n=10) | 109 | 98-118 |
Urine (Nitrite Assay) (n=10) | 101 | 87-112 |

This assay procedure measures the concentration of endogenous nitrite present in the sample. Bring all reagents and samples to room temperature before use. It is recommended that all samples and standards be assayed in duplicate.
- Prepare all reagents, standard dilutions, and samples as directed in the product insert.
- Remove excess microplate strips from the plate frame, return them to the foil pouch containing the desiccant pack, and reseal.
- Add 50 µL of Reaction Diluent (1X) to the Blank wells.
- Add 50 µL of Nitrite Standard or sample to the remaining wells.
- Add 50 µL of Reaction Diluent (1X) to all wells.
- Add 50 µL of Griess Reagent I to all wells.
- Add 50 µL of Griess Reagent II to all wells. Mix by gently tapping the side of the plate.
- Incubate at room temperature for 10 minutes. Read at 540 nm with wavelength correction at 690 nm.

This assay procedure measures total nitrite by converting nitrate to nitrite. To determine the nitrate concentration in the sample, the endogenous nitrite concentration measured from the Nitrite Assay Procedure must be subtracted from the converted nitrite concentration measured in this procedure. Bring all reagents and samples to room temperature before use. It is recommended that all samples and standards be assayed in duplicate.
- Prepare all reagents, standard dilutions, and samples as directed in the product insert.
- Remove excess microplate strips from the plate frame, return them to the foil pouch containing the desiccant pack, and reseal.
- Add 50 µL of Reaction Diluent (1X) to the Blank wells.
- Add 50 µL of Nitrate Standard or sample to the remaining wells.
- Add 25 µL of NADH to all wells.
- Add 25 µL of diluted Nitrate Reductase to all wells. Mix well, cover with a plate sealer, and incubate at 37 °C for 30 minutes.
- Add 50 µL of Griess Reagent I to all wells.
- Add 50 µL of Griess Reagent II to all wells. Mix by gently tapping the side of the plate.
- Incubate at room temperature for 10 minutes. Read at 540 nm with wavelength correction at 690 nm.

Total Nitric Oxide and Nitrate/Nitrite Parameter Assay Kit Summary
Format
96-well strip plate
Assay Length
< 1 hour
Sample Type & Volume Required Per Well
Cell Culture Supernates (10 uL), Serum (25 uL), EDTA Plasma (25 uL), Heparin Plasma (25 uL), Citrate Plasma (25 uL), Urine (10 uL)
Sensitivity
0.78 umol/L
Assay Range
3.1 - 200 umol/L (Cell Culture Supernates, Serum, EDTA Plasma, Heparin Plasma, Citrate Plasma, Urine)
Specificity
Measures Total Nitric Oxide, Nitrite and Nitrate levels in various samples
Cross-reactivity
< 0.5% cross-reactivity observed with available related molecules.< 50% cross-species reactivity observed with species tested.
